How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Madras?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Madras Studio Apartments | $1,699 | $1,350 | $2,345 |
Madras 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,864 | $1,495 | $2,825 |
Madras 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,214 | $1,275 | $4,325 |
Madras 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,400 | $1,875 | $3,644 |
Madras 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,661 | $2,495 | $2,795 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Madras
How much are Studio apartments in Madras?
There are currently 13 Studio Apartments in Madras with rent ranges from $1,350 to $2,345 with an average price of $1,699.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Madras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Madras ranges from $1,495 to $2,825 with an average monthly rent of $1,864.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Madras c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Madras range from $1,275 to $4,325.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,214.
How expensive are Madras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 20 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Madras on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,875 to $3,644 - averaging $2,400 for the location.
